public class JmixRememberMeServices
extends org.springframework.security.web.authentication.rememberme.PersistentTokenBasedRememberMeServices
Constructor and Description |
---|
JmixRememberMeServices(java.lang.String key,
org.springframework.security.core.userdetails.UserDetailsService userDetailsService,
org.springframework.security.web.authentication.rememberme.PersistentTokenRepository tokenRepository) |
Modifier and Type | Method and Description |
---|---|
protected void |
enhanceSession(javax.servlet.http.HttpSession session) |
protected void |
onLoginSuccess(jav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response,
org.springframework.security.core.Authentication successfulAuthentication) |
protected boolean |
rememberMeRequested(javax.servlet.http.HttpServletRequest request,
java.lang.String parameter) |
generateSeriesData, generateTokenData, logout, processAutoLoginCookie, setSeriesLength, setTokenLength, setTokenValiditySeconds
afterPropertiesSet, autoLogin, cancelCookie, createSuccessfulAuthentication, decodeCookie, encodeCookie, extractRememberMeCookie, getAuthenticationDetailsSource, getCookieName, getKey, getParameter, getTokenValiditySeconds, getUserDetailsService, loginFail, loginSuccess, onLoginFail, setAlwaysRemember, setAuthenticationDetailsSource, setAuthoritiesMapper, setCookie, setCookieDomain, setCookieName, setMessageSource, setParameter, setUserDetailsChecker, setUseSecureCookie
public JmixRememberMeServices(java.lang.String key, org.springframework.security.core.userdetails.UserDetailsService userDetailsService, org.springframework.security.web.authentication.rememberme.PersistentTokenRepository tokenRepository)
protected boolean rememberMeRequested(javax.servlet.http.HttpServletRequest request, java.lang.String parameter)
rememberMeRequested
in class org.springframework.security.web.authentication.rememberme.AbstractRememberMeServices
protected void onLoginSuccess(jav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response, org.springframework.security.core.Authentication successfulAuthentication)
onLoginSuccess
in class org.springframework.security.web.authentication.rememberme.PersistentTokenBasedRememberMeServices
protected void enhanceSession(javax.servlet.http.HttpSession session)